Output 47c6bae2d1f619bf8482a8d6fc2eacfe85837d8ce896a9ddb51a821855f357e3:4

value
586490149
script pubkey
OP_0 OP_PUSHBYTES_20 80aaf75c1c1d422780318585f8fce8a4623061e3
address
bc1qsz40whqur4pz0qp3skzl3l8g533rqc0rruj5td
transaction
47c6bae2d1f619bf8482a8d6fc2eacfe85837d8ce896a9ddb51a821855f357e3
confirmations
315267
spent
true